In the 17th century, in response to the rise of Protestantism, the Church decided to strike the minds of the faithful with a demonstrative theatrical art blending architecture, painting, sculpture and music.

 
 

Its remarkably rich baroque heritage is a major cultural focus of interest for tourism on the French Riviera: more than eighty monuments, churches, chapels, palaces and citadels to discover along the Route du Baroque Nisso-Ligure.

 

   
 

Nice & Menton, gems of Baroque art

 




The 17th century was an essential period in the evolution of Nice. In the profusion of the Baroque Age, the city acquired its own identity, distancing itself once and for all from its Provençal roots.

 
 

The remarkably decorated parvis of Saint-Michel church offers a sumptuous setting for the Music Festival of Menton every summer.
